This book was epic and so enthralling - it had me at the edge of my seat & got me out of a very long reading slump. I thoroughly enjoyed the way the story played out and how parts of the mystery were revealed. I also enjoyed how Maya and Naomi’s characters were written with so much depth and layers. The twist at the end was a real surprise - though I found it a bit confusing that Margaret killed Matthew because isn’t she also a St Clair and reliant on her ties to Greystone? . That was one plot hole that I can’t reconcile. But overall, great read!
